I'll answer my own question.
According to our comms:
"Officers from the Environment Agency and Medway Council’s Environmental Protection Team have identified the source of the smell that people have noticed today. The odour has been pinpointed to a wood recycling plant in Chatham Docks.
Stock piles are high at the docks as a plant in Sweden that the wood is destined for has been closed for essential maintenance. The plant is now open and the priority is to ship out the stock as quickly as possible."

Apparently the wood is for the Scandanavian wood burning power stations, but the stock levels got out of sync due to the weather and large numbers of people on holiday (so power not needed as much).
As it's a fairly new contract they hope to learn from their inventory mistakes.
IIRC hearing, the storage location will be moved slightly as so any dust etc won't pollute the river
